Richard selznick is a child psychologist who has helped parents with their childrens struggles in school for more than 25 years. As selznick explains it, the shutdown learner tends to be a problemsolver, someone who learns spatially and thrives with handson tasks that load on visual and spatial abilities. The shutdown learner sdl is based on his experience working with parents and students who are not doing well in school. The shutdown learner is based on the authors clinical experience as director of a program in the pediatrics department of a large teaching hospital that assesses and treats a broad range of learning problems.
